1. Introduction to Direct Burial Fiber Optic Cable Technology


A direct burial fiber optic cable is a specially engineered outdoor fiber cable designed to be installed directly into underground soil without the need for conduit protection. Unlike duct cables or aerial fiber systems, direct burial designs must withstand:

  • Soil pressure and ground movement

  • Moisture ingress and water exposure

  • Rodent and mechanical damage

  • Temperature fluctuations

  • Long-term environmental degradation

To address these challenges, Angnet Technology integrates multi-layer protective structures such as:

  • Steel wire armor (SWA) or steel tape armor

  • Water-blocking gel or dry core technology

  • High-density polyethylene (HDPE) outer sheath

  • Reinforced loose-tube fiber structures

These engineering enhancements ensure that direct burial fiber optic cable systems maintain signal integrity and mechanical stability over decades of deployment.

3. What Makes Direct Burial Fiber Optic Cable Essential in Modern Networks


The global shift toward high-speed broadband, 5G deployment, and smart infrastructure has significantly increased demand for underground fiber networks. In these environments, direct burial fiber optic cable offers several key advantages:

direct burial fiber optic cable

3.1 High Mechanical Protection

Direct burial cables are reinforced with armor layers such as:

  • Corrugated steel tape (CST)

  • Steel wire armoring

  • Double polyethylene jackets

These structures protect against:

  • Excavation damage

  • Compression forces

  • Rodent attacks

3.2 Environmental Resistance

Underground installations expose cables to moisture, chemicals, and soil pressure. Angnet’s designs include:

  • Water-blocking compounds

  • Gel-filled or dry water-blocking cores

  • UV-resistant outer jackets

This ensures long-term reliability even in challenging soil conditions.


3.3 Reduced Infrastructure Cost

Unlike duct-based systems, direct burial fiber optic cable installations eliminate the need for conduit pipelines, significantly reducing:

  • Construction cost

  • Installation time

  • Maintenance complexity


3.4 High Transmission Stability

Fiber cores are protected against micro-bending and macro-bending losses, ensuring:

  • Low attenuation

  • Stable bandwidth

  • Long-distance transmission performance


4. Structural Design of Angnet Direct Burial Fiber Optic Cable


Angnet Technology engineers its direct burial cable series with advanced structural configurations optimized for global telecom environments.


4.1 Loose Tube Construction

The core of the cable uses loose tube technology, where optical fibers are placed inside buffer tubes filled with gel. This design allows:

  • Thermal expansion flexibility

  • Mechanical stress isolation

  • Fiber protection under pressure


4.2 Steel Armored Protection Layer

Depending on the model, Angnet integrates:

  • Steel tape armored (STA) designs

  • Steel wire armored (SWA) designs

  • Dual-armored composite structures

These layers provide excellent crush resistance for underground burial.


4.3 Moisture Barrier System

Moisture protection is achieved through:

  • Aluminum polyethylene laminate (APL)

  • Water-blocking yarn

  • Gel-filled interstices

This prevents water penetration and signal degradation.


4.4 Outer Jacket Material

The external sheath is typically made from:

  • MDPE (Medium Density Polyethylene)

  • HDPE (High Density Polyethylene)

These materials ensure:

  • Chemical resistance

  • UV stability

  • Long-term burial durability


5. Key Product Variants of Direct Burial Fiber Optic Cable


Angnet Technology provides multiple configurations to suit different engineering requirements:

GYTA Series

5.1 GYTA Series (Steel Tape Armored)

  • Designed for general underground burial

  • Excellent moisture resistance

  • Suitable for long-distance telecom backbone networks


5.2 GYTS Series (Enhanced Mechanical Protection)

  • Improved crush resistance

  • Steel tape + double jacket structure

  • Ideal for urban infrastructure projects

GYTA53 / GYTS53 Heavy-Duty Models

5.3 GYTA53 / GYTS53 Heavy-Duty Models

  • Dual-layer armor system

  • Designed for extreme underground environments

  • Used in industrial zones and highway crossings

These product families ensure that Angnet can meet diverse direct burial fiber optic cable installation requirements, from rural broadband expansion to metropolitan fiber backbone systems.
